Frequently Asked Questions

What does B fervidus mean?

B. fervidus is a member of the order Hymenoptera, which comprises wasps, ants, bees, and sawflies. Bombus is the Latin word for "buzzing". It is also in the Apidae, which is a diverse family of bees including honeybees, orchid bees, bumble bees, stingless bees, cuckoo bees, and carpenter bees.

What does fervid mean?

Definition of fervid. 1 : very hot : burning. 2 : marked by often extreme fervor (see fervor sense 1) a fervid crusader fervid fans.

What does ferve mean in Latin?

The Latin verb fervēre can mean "to boil" or "to glow," as well as, by extension, "to seethe" or "to be roused.". In English, this root gives us three words that can mean "impassioned" by varying degrees: "fervid," "fervent," and "perfervid.". What is the difference between fervent and fervid?

"Fervid" and "fervent" are practically synonymous, but while "fervid" usually suggests warm emotion that is expressed in a spontaneous or feverish manner (as in "fervid basketball fans"), "fervent" is reserved for a kind of emotional warmth that is steady and sincere (as in "a fervent belief in human kindness").
